Shoplifting trio guilty of killing man who died days after being attacked
John McDonnell, 44, Daniel Carroll, 29, and Jonathan Bristow, 46, all attacked Matthew Griggs twice in the space of an hour.

The group - which also included the now deceased Andrew Gough - were angry with Mr Griggs.
They believed he had inadvertently brought attention on them after they stole alcohol from the BP service station on Plumstead Road, Norwich.

The 38-year-old suffered fractured ribs in the attacks on September 19 2023 and died as a result of his injuries four days later.

Mr Griggs was pronounced dead in an area of woodland off Church Lane, Sprowston, on September 23 2023.
McDonnell, of Recorder Road, Carroll, of no fixed address, and Bristow, latterly of Trafalgar Street, have all been on trial at Norwich Crown Court after they denied manslaughter.

But jurors took just over four hours and 10 minutes to find all three defendants guilty on Monday afternoon (April 13).

Judge Anthony Bate adjourned sentence for a date to be fixed.

Speaking after the verdicts, senior investigating officer, Detective Inspector Alix Wright said: “Throughout this process, officers have worked diligently to piece together the circumstances of this case.

“This has been a long and complex investigation, and today’s conviction marks a significant moment for everyone involved - most importantly, for the victim’s family.
"We hope this outcome brings them some measure of comfort as they continue to cope with their loss.”

The trial which started last month, heard Mr Griggs was attacked by the group twice - first at Ketts Hill and then on Prince of Wales Road - as they returned to a property in Ketts Hill after stealing alcohol from a nearby garage.

They had been angered to find Mr Griggs outside the address, waiting for his girlfriend Sharleen Dowd, as they thought his presence would make the property a target for police, who had been alerted about their shoplifting.

Miss Dowd, who was with Mr Griggs when he had been attacked and who found him unresponsive in their tent four days after, told the court he had been in the "worst pain ever".

he couple had walked back to their tent, in woodland near Church Lane, Sprowston, from the city centre - a distance of less than three miles.

Miss Dowd, 38, said he had to stop every two minutes because of the pain, meaning it took them around two hours.
"He wanted to cry because he was in that much pain," she said.
"He kept stopping as he couldn't breathe."
When they got back he was "dozing off" and "complaining he was in pain".
Tearfully Miss Dowd said she could hear Mr Griggs "begging me to get up" but she could not as she had taken medication.
"When I was sleeping he obviously fell asleep - or I thought he was asleep, but he had gone," she added.
